Deputy Speaker of Nigeria’s House of Representatives, Benjamin Kalu, says President Bola Tinubu has shown his determination to address all issues affecting Nigeria’s South-east geopolitical zone with the signing of the South-east Development Commission bill into law,.
The Deputy Speaker in a statement by his Chief Press Secretary thanked President Tinubu, his colleagues in the national assembly and all Nigerians for supporting the bill.

Kalu, with lawmakers from the South-east in the House of Representatives sponsored the bill which sought the establishment of the commission that will be charged with the responsibility to receive and manage fund from allocation of the federation account for the reconstruction and rehabilitation of roads, houses and other infrastructural damage suffered by the region as a result of the effect of the civil war after 54 years.
The commission is also set to tackle the ecological problems and any other related environmental or developmental challenge in the South-eastern states – Abia, Imo, Enugu, Anambra, and Ebonyi.
